How To Break Big Rocks In Harvestella
In Harvestella, you can break the big rocks found around your farm by upgrading your Hammer. You can do that by unlocking Shirii, the Great Earth Faerie, by completing the story Chapter 3C and completing six tasks for him.

After you finish Chapter 2 – Omen, you will reach Chapter 3, with three sub Chapters 3A, 3B, and 3C. There is no order to complete the said Chapters, and you can proceed as you wish.
If you are confident enough with your combat skill and have your weapon upgraded and a few meals prepared for battle, you can directly tackle Chapter 3C before completing 3A and 3B to unlock Shirii fast. Once you have him on your farm at the Bird’s Eye Brae, you take specific tasks from him, ranging from farming certain crops to building specific structures to unlock the Hammer upgrade finally.

Since the tasks are retroactive, you may have already completed one or two of his tasks before unlocking him at the Bird’s Eye Brae. To turn-in the tasks, head inside your house and interact with the glowing book.
Once you are done with any six tasks from the Shirii, you will get the Hammer upgrade. Next, go to the field, select the Hammer and start hitting the big rocks by holding the action button. Doing so will break the big rocks and finally give you more space for farming activities.
